FAQs

Absolutely. 'Martha Marcy May Marlene' transcends typical genre boundaries, offering a sophisticated and deeply unsettling psychological thriller. Its strength lies not in jump scares or overt action, but in its gradual build-up of dread and its exploration of fractured mental states. The film's focus on the lingering psychological impact of trauma and manipulation makes it a compelling and thought-provoking watch for fans of the genre seeking something more introspective and character-focused.
